    Abstract: The present invention generally provides mold modules for constructing boat hulls, methods of constructing boat hulls using the mold modules, and hulls constructed using the mold modules. The modules may be adjustable, and may be included in a kit for building the hull of many boats of different dimensions but generally the same shape. Each mold module generally comprises a mold in a shape complementary to that of a portion of a boat hull, and an edge mold to form the edge of the hull part formed by that mold module. A mold module according to the present invention may also comprise one or more mold adjustment areas, and calibrators for selecting the boat hull dimensions. Methods for using the aforementioned mold modules generally comprise steps of molding hull parts, removing them from the mold modules, aligning them and finally attaching them together.

    Abstract: Left and right main hoppers offset laterally from each other on opposite sides of the centerline of a seeding machine provide an operator access area between the hoppers. A third hopper located forwardly of and between the two main hoppers has a capacity less than that of each of the main hoppers for refuge or male seed. The hoppers are sized to maximize productivity. In one embodiment, first and second hoppers communicate with downstream conduit structure, and valve structure selects one or the other of the first and second hoppers for delivery of the material. The valve structure can be operated remotely and can be map based. Alternatively, selectively blockable nozzle structure is located in the first and second hoppers. Easily changeable connector structure facilitates row pattern selection and hose routing.

    Abstract: Repair strips can be inserted between courses of shakes or shingles in a wooden shake or shingle roof. The repair strip has a thin upper edge for insertion into the interface between two courses of shakes or shingles. A lower part of the repair strip is structured to provide air channels on one or both of its top and bottom faces. Gripping members may be provided to hold the repair strips in place.

    Abstract: A seed meter is provided with a stationary housing having an inlet for receiving seed and an outlet for dispensing metered seed. A rotatable circular member is located adjacent the stationary housing and forms a seed puddle there between. The circular member is provided with seed receiving cells for transporting individual seeds from the seed puddle to the outlet. An internal seed knockout assembly having a rotatable wheel drives trapped seed from seed receiving cells into the outlet.

    Abstract: A joist bridge has a web extending between a pair of end members. The web has a straight edge and an edge having a central indentation. The indentation provides a space through which plumbing pipes, electrical conduits and wiring and the like can be run. The joist bridge is economical of material and is therefore relatively inexpensive to manufacture. An adhesive strip may be provided along the top of the joist bridge to bond the joist bridge to the flooring above.
